Pixel2Lines

服务
照片到 SVG 线稿
照片到 SVG 线稿
照片到 SVG 激光雕刻
照片到 SVG 激光雕刻
照片转 SVG 矢量化
照片转 SVG 矢量化
Manual Ink Pro
Manual Ink Pro
SVG→DXF
SVG to DXF
SVG→G-Code
SVG to G-Code
图像放大器
图像放大器
移除背景
移除背景
刺绣打版
刺绣打版
画廊定价SVG 编辑器
工作空间
  1. 首页/
  2. 指南与资源/
  3. SVG 笔绘图优化:减少绘图时间和笔升降

优化 SVG 文件以实现高效笔绘图

未经优化的矢量文件会在不必要的笔移动中浪费时间。战略路径组织和优化技术极大地减少了绘图时间,同时提高了输出质量。

了解绘图效率低下

Raw SVG files exported from design software contain paths in arbitrary order—sequence of creation, layer organization, or random.绘图仪按文件顺序执行路径,导致笔行程过多。示例:在顶部绘制线,跳至底部,返回相邻线的顶部。钢笔旅行的时间比绘画的时间还多。

笔升降成本高昂:抬起笔、移动到新位置、降低笔需要时间并引入注册风险。未经优化的文件可能会不必要地提笔数千次。每次提升:约 0.1-0.3 秒加上行程时间。 1000 unnecessary lifts = 2-5 minutes wasted minimum, often much more with long travel distances.

笔画方向很重要:绘图仪可以向前或向后移动路径。 Unoptimized plotting may finish path, lift pen, travel far, when reversing previous path and continuing would eliminate lift.智能优化可以检测这些机会并链接路径。

设计文件中常见的重复几何图形:隐藏的重复项、分组的原始+副本、重叠的相同路径。 Plotter draws everything causing wasted time and potentially darker lines from double-plotting.在绘图之前检测并删除重复项至关重要。

Layer organization in design software rarely optimizes for plot efficiency.设计师通过视觉逻辑(前景/背景)或编辑便利性来组织,而不是笔的移动。按原样绘制图层会浪费时间。通过空间邻近性进行重组可以减少出行。

SVG 绘图仪图优化
SVG 绘图仪优化
绘制时间检查清单图
绘图时间检查

路径排序策略

最近邻排序:完成路径后,无论原始顺序如何,都移动到最近的未绘制路径。 Greedy algorithm—not globally optimal but dramatically better than unsorted.通常可减少 60-80% 的笔行程。 Easiest optimization to implement, available in most plotter software.

Layer-based sorting: plot all paths in one area before moving to another. Divide drawing into grid, sort paths by grid cell. More sophisticated than nearest-neighbor, accounts for clustering.防止跨页之字形图案。 Useful for large-format plots where travel distance significant relative to drawing size.

多色绘图基于颜色的排序:按画笔颜色对所有路径进行分组,在更改画笔之前绘制一种颜色的所有实例。最大限度地减少笔的更换(许多绘图仪上耗时的手动过程)。权衡:可能会增加笔的总行程,但会减少用户干预。计算更换钢笔所节省的时间与旅行中损失的时间。

由内向外或由外向内:对于嵌套形状(圆套圆、同心图案),从中心向外或边缘向内绘制。在嵌套元素之间移动时减少笔抬起。取决于设计——选择在给定布局下最小化总行程的方向。

刀具路径优化算法:旅行商问题解决者找到接近最佳的路径顺序。与未分类相比,复杂的优化减少了 70-90% 的行程。对于大文件来说计算密集型 - 优化数千条路径可能需要几分钟,但可以节省绘图时间。重复情节或很长的情节值得投资。

优化工作流程

  1. 1

    清理 SVG 文件

    删除隐藏图层,删除不用于绘图的构造指南,将所有内容取消组合到单独的路径,根据需要将笔画转换为路径,删除填充(绘图仪仅绘制笔画)。使用矢量软件的“简化路径”来减少不必要的锚点——更少的点=更快的处理和更平滑的绘图。验证没有重复的路径(选择全部,检查计数,撤消并手动取消选择明显的路径,剩余的选择是重复的)。

  2. 2

    按情节策略组织

    单色:使用优化软件按空间邻近度排序。多色:按颜色将路径分成图层,独立对每个颜色图层进行排序,确定绘图顺序(背景到前景或按画笔更改频率)。复杂的设计:手动组织关键部分,自动优化剩余部分。始终保持审美意图——不要为了节省边际时间而牺牲设计质量。

  3. 3

    应用优化软件

    工具:vpype(Python命令行工具,功能强大)、AxiDraw软件(内置优化)、带绘图仪插件的Inkscape、自定义脚本。运行优化:最近邻作为基线,如果时间允许,尝试高级算法,预览优化的路径顺序(许多工具可视化),估计节省的时间(比较路径长度指标)。在完整绘图之前测试部分设计。

  4. 4

    验证和测试图

    检查优化是否在视觉上改变了路径(放大,比较之前/之后),确保所有路径都存在(在优化之前/之后进行计数),测试绘图小部分以验证笔不会由于优化的速度变化而跳过,测量测试绘图上的实际时间节省,如果结果不令人满意则进行迭代。记录未来类似项目的优化设置。

先进的优化技术

路径合并:当多条线段形成连续路径且没有分支时,合并为单条路径,消除电梯。示例:剖面线图案可以导出为单独的线 - 合并为连续的锯齿形可以消除每条线之间的提升。有些软件会自动执行此操作,有些则需要手动干预或编写脚本。

笔划合并:如果可能,将相邻的平行笔划组合成单个路径。紧密间隔的细线的粗外观有时会变成单个较粗的路径。权衡:稍微改变渲染,显着减少绘图时间。仅当视觉差异可接受时。

战略性开辟道路:与直觉相反,有时打破道路会减少总时间。穿过整个绘图的长路径可能会更快地分成用局部簇绘制的片段。很少有优化,但对于特定布局(网格图案、分散元素)很有用。

颜色顺序优化:分析多色设计的换笔频率。如果设计使用 5 种颜色,但仅在小区域中使用一种颜色,则尽管空间效率低下,但最后使用其他颜色绘制该区域 - 节省换笔时间。根据设计细节和绘图笔更换速度平衡空间和颜色优化。

自适应细节:根据观看距离改变路径密度。近距离观察的区域可以获得完整的细节,远处的区域则被简化。减少路径数、更快的绘图、难以察觉的质量损失。需要手动判断——小心地自动化。 Most applicable to large-format work where viewing distance varies across piece.

优化软件工具

vpype(开源Python):命令行工具,功能极其强大。命令:linemerge(连接共线段)、linesort(优化路径顺序)、reloop(优化循环方向)、裁剪/过滤/变换操作。陡峭的学习曲线但无与伦比的控制。对于认真的绘图仪用户来说至关重要。 Install via pip, use in scripts for batch processing.

Inkscape 带 AxiDraw 扩展:可视化界面,适合初学者。内置路径排序、预览绘图顺序、手动覆盖选项。限制:不如 vpype 复杂,处理大文件速度较慢。优点:视觉反馈,更容易学习。适合大多数用户。

AxiDraw software: if using AxiDraw plotter, included software has optimization.自动最近邻排序、分层管理、路径方向控制。针对 AxiDraw 细节进行优化。运行良好,但与特定硬件相关。

自定义脚本:带有 svgpathtools 或 svg.path 库的 Python。为独特需求编写自定义优化。示例:特定领域的路径排序、与设计自动化的集成、批量优化管道。需要编程知识,但需要终极灵活性。

商业绘图仪:一些高端绘图仪(HP、Roland)包括驱动程序软件的优化。因型号而异 - 请检查文档。通常不如专用工具灵活,但如果可用的话也很方便。

优化实际上可以节省多少时间?

取决于文件的复杂性和初始组织。典型的节省:简单设计 20-30%(主要来自重复删除),复杂设计 40-60%(路径排序主要影响),非常低效的文件 70-80%(初始组织不良)。示例:未优化孵化肖像3小时→优化45分钟。优化所投入的时间(5-15 分钟)很快就恢复了。对于一次性绘图,基本优化是值得的。对于重复的绘图或版本,高级优化至关重要——可以节省印刷时间。

优化会改变我的设计外观吗?

适当的优化只会改变路径顺序和方向,而不会改变几何形状。视觉输出相同。注意:一些激进的优化(路径合并、简化)可能会改变外观。始终:在绘图之前预览优化路径,测试打印小部分,与原始设计意图进行比较。如果优化改变了外观,请使用不太激进的设置或接受更长的绘图时间。除非有意进行艺术选择,否则切勿为了节省时间而牺牲设计质量。

我应该优化一次并保存文件还是每次绘图时都优化?

两种方法都有效。保存优化文件,如果:多次绘制相同的设计,优化耗时(文件大,算法复杂),使用版本控制(单独跟踪优化版本)。每次重新优化如果:经常修改设计、使用不同的纸张尺寸(优化不同)、尝试不同的优化策略。建议:保留原始未优化的设计文件作为主文件,根据需要生成优化的绘图文件。切勿用优化版本覆盖原始版本 - 失去可编辑性。

生产前验证清单

  • 在目标软件中确认最终尺寸、单位和方向
  • 检查文件中是否存在隐藏、重复或不相关的几何图形
  • 在全面生产之前进行小型材料或缝纫测试
  • 将批准的设置、源文件和导出的生产文件一起保存

相关指南

笔式绘图仪的工作原理:运动、文件和线条质量

继续本生产文件系列中的下一个实用工作流程。

笔式绘图仪的剖面线和交叉剖面线:间距、角度和绘图时间

继续本生产文件系列中的下一个实用工作流程。

用Pixel2Lines准备清洁生产文件

当您需要在生产前将图稿转换为更干净的 SVG、DXF、刺绣或机器就绪输出时,请使用 Pixel2Lines。

以 Pixel2Lines 开头

想要先清洁或测量您的 SVG?

在浏览器中打开免费的 SVG 编辑器,检查比例、清理路径,并在无需上传文件的情况下导出可直接交付的文件。

评论

请登录或创建账户才能发表评论。

登录或注册

正在加载评论...

专业流程服务


  • 照片到 SVG 线稿矢量
  • 照片到 SVG 激光雕刻矢量
  • 照片转 SVG 矢量化矢量
  • Manual Ink Pro矢量
  • 照片到刺绣打版矢量
  • 建筑插画位图
  • 移除背景位图
  • SVG to G-Code矢量
  • SVG to DXF矢量
  • 画廊
  • 定价
  • 关于我们
  • 技术
  • 定制开发
  • 联系支持人员

转换工具


  • 文件转换器
  • JPG 转 PNG
  • JPG 转 WebP
  • JPG 转 AVIF
  • JPG 转 ICO
  • PNG 转 JPG
  • PNG 转 AVIF
  • PNG 转 WebP
  • PNG 转 ICO
  • WebP 转 JPG
  • WebP 转 PNG
  • WebP 转 AVIF
  • AVIF 转 JPG
  • AVIF 转 PNG
  • AVIF 转 WebP
  • SVG 转 PNG
  • SVG 转 JPG
  • SVG 转 WebP
  • SVG 转 AVIF
  • SVG 转 PDF高级
  • SVG 转 EPS高级
  • SVG 转 AI高级
  • PDF 转 PNG
  • BMP 转 PNG
  • DXF 转 SVG高级

指南


  • 有用的指南

Pixel2Lines

  • 法律
  • 隐私政策
  • 条款
  • Cookie